Information about the product

Our Turtle Cap:

  • 100% organic cotton
  • Fabric weight: 8 oz/yd² (271 g/m²)
  • 3/1 twill
  • Unstructured
  • 6-panel
  • Matching sewn eyelets
  • Self-fabric adjustable closure with a brass slider and hidden tuck-in
  • Raw product sourced from China

Cool Facts

  • Respiration and Sleep
    Sea turtles must surface regularly to breathe, yet they can sleep for an astonishing seven hours underwater before taking another breath. Their metabolism and heart rate slow down significantly to conserve oxygen – there can be up to nine minutes between heartbeats.
  • Navigation
    To orient themselves, turtles use the Earth's magnetic field and currents, which help them determine their paths. The leatherback turtle is particularly impressive in this regard, diving up to 1000 meters deep.
  • Reproduction and Life Cycle
    Female turtles always return to their birth beach to lay their eggs there. However, only one out of a thousand hatchlings reaches adulthood.
  • Speed and Adaptability
    In water, sea turtles usually swim at a speed of one to ten km/h, but can reach peaks of 25 km/h. For 225 million years, they have defied climatic changes and natural disasters and are considered the oldest living reptiles.

habitat

Meeresschildkröten leben in den tropischen und subtropischen Meeren weltweit, in denen die Wassertemperatur niemals unter 20 Grad Celsius fällt.

kind

Es gibt sieben bekannte Arten von Meeresschildkröten.

lifespan

Je nach Art können sie zwischen 30 und 100 Jahre alt werden.

Size

Die Größe von Wasserschildkröten variiert je nach Art.

  • Die Lederschildkröte (Dermochelys coriacea) ist die größte Meeresschildkrötenart. Sie kann eine beeindruckende Größe von über 2 Metern erreichen und ein Gewicht von mehreren hundert Kilogramm haben.
  • Die kleinste Meeresschildkrötenart ist die Karettschildkröte (Eretmochelys imbricata). Sie ist im Vergleich zu anderen Meeresschildkröten relativ klein und erreicht eine Länge von etwa 70-90 Zentimetern und ein Gewicht von etwa 40-60 Kilogramm.
